实时录制音视频如何实现画面裁剪?

在当今数字化时代,实时录制音视频已成为人们日常生活中不可或缺的一部分。然而,如何实现画面裁剪,使得视频内容更加精炼、高效,成为了许多用户关注的焦点。本文将为您详细介绍实时录制音视频画面裁剪的实现方法,帮助您轻松掌握这一技能。

实时录制音视频画面裁剪的原理

实时录制音视频画面裁剪主要基于视频编辑技术。通过提取视频帧,对画面进行定位、裁剪和拼接,最终实现视频画面的裁剪。以下为具体步骤:

  1. 提取视频帧:首先,将实时录制的音视频转换为帧序列。这一过程可以通过视频处理库(如OpenCV)实现。

  2. 定位裁剪区域:根据用户需求,确定需要裁剪的画面区域。例如,可以指定裁剪区域的起始帧、结束帧以及裁剪区域的宽度和高度。

  3. 裁剪画面:在提取的视频帧中,根据裁剪区域对画面进行裁剪。这一步骤可以通过图像处理技术实现。

  4. 拼接视频帧:将裁剪后的视频帧重新拼接成视频序列,形成新的视频文件。

实现实时录制音视频画面裁剪的方法

以下是几种实现实时录制音视频画面裁剪的方法:

  1. 基于视频处理库:利用OpenCV等视频处理库,结合Python、C++等编程语言,实现实时录制音视频画面裁剪。

  2. 利用在线工具:一些在线视频编辑工具支持实时录制音视频画面裁剪功能,用户只需上传视频文件,即可在线完成裁剪。

  3. 使用专业软件:Adobe Premiere Pro、Final Cut Pro等视频编辑软件支持实时录制音视频画面裁剪功能,用户可根据实际需求进行操作。

案例分析

以下为一个实际案例:

某直播平台需要实时录制主播的画面,但画面中包含了无关信息。为了提高视频质量,平台采用实时录制音视频画面裁剪技术,将主播画面裁剪至指定区域。经过测试,该技术成功实现了画面裁剪,提高了视频质量,受到了用户的好评。

总结

实时录制音视频画面裁剪技术为用户提供了便捷的视频编辑手段。通过掌握相关原理和方法,用户可以轻松实现画面裁剪,提高视频质量。在实际应用中,用户可根据自身需求选择合适的方法,实现实时录制音视频画面裁剪。

猜你喜欢:什么是RTC